Output e304f59794d8a062af895140817b4b9dd477eb4a3d951b4b6ce10e7af3298265:3

value
43400000
script pubkey
OP_0 OP_PUSHBYTES_20 ccb41f2829872af12e42dab48f7baabcacce4409
address
ltc1qej6p72pfsu40ztjzm26g77a2hjkvu3qfkh3qjn
transaction
e304f59794d8a062af895140817b4b9dd477eb4a3d951b4b6ce10e7af3298265
spent
true